摘要
This paper reports new data on the geology and stratigraphy of the Upper Jurassic-Lower Cretaceous deposits of the eastern part of the Oloy zone (upper reaches of the Oloy, Ilguveem, Aluchin rivers), including the description of sections, lithological-petrographic and paleontological characteristics of volcaniclastic sediments, the results of petrological-geochemical study of volcanic rocks, and their isotope dating. Two concordant dates were obtained using the zircon U-Pb method: 147 & PLUSMN; 2 Ma (Elom Formation) and 140 & PLUSMN; 2 Ma (Glukhovskaya Formation). The island-arc nature of the studied formations has been substantiated. The facies conditions and geodynamic settings of all stages of the formation of the volcanic-sedimentary complex in the various structural-facies zones have been characterized.
